On Saturday, the Thunderbolts and Head Coach/Director of Hockey Operations Jeff Bes announced the signing of defenseman Jake Mendeszoon to a Professional Tryout (PTO).
Mendeszoon joins the Thunderbolts following the conclusion of his collegiate hockey season at Western New England University, where he played alongside recent Thunderbolts signing Nolan Dawson, with whom he tied the team lead in scoring with 15 points, and like Dawson served as an alternate captain. The Methuen, Massachusetts native played four seasons of college hockey with Western New England (2023-2025) and SUNY-Brockport (2021-2023), scoring 4 goals and 34 points in 97 regular season games. Prior to college, Mendeszoon played two seasons of college hockey with the New Hampshire Avalanche of the EHL between 2018-2020, scoring 11 goals and 60 points in 88 games, and won an EHL Championship in 2018-19.
